Function FVAK_INIT pattern details

In-order to call this FM within your sap programs, simply using the below ABAP pattern details to trigger the function call...or see the full ABAP code listing at the end of this article. You can simply cut and paste this code into your ABAP progrom as it is, including variable declarations.
CALL FUNCTION 'FVAK_INIT'"
EXPORTING
I_DIALOG_MODE = "
I_VIOB01 = "
* I_VIOB02 = "
* I_VIOB03 = "
I_PROGNAME = "
* I_LOADED_AREAS = 'F' "
I_DYNNR_HEADER = "
.



IMPORTING Parameters details for FVAK_INIT

I_DIALOG_MODE -

Data type:
Optional: No
Call by Reference: Yes

I_VIOB01 -

Data type: VIOB01
Optional: No
Call by Reference: Yes

I_VIOB02 -

Data type: VIOB02
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es

I_VIOB03 -

Data type: VIOB03
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es

I_PROGNAME -

Data type: SY-CPROG
Optional: No
Call by Reference: Yes

I_LOADED_AREAS -

Data type: CHAR1
Default: 'F'
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es

I_DYNNR_HEADER -

Data type: SY-DYNNR
Optional: No
Call by Reference: Yes
